Best way to raise motor so I can replace motor mount?
I have the floor jack and a suitable piece of wood but was wondering about what i need to disconnect first and placement. I ask because some tutorials say you don't have to disconnect much while others mention much more. Thanks!
What year is your mini? Look at the pelican parts website they have a good write up on putting a pulley on. It is the same process to replace the upper mount. When I did mine I only loosend the trans mount mount and let the motor pivot on it just one less thing to try and line up later. I also put the jack towards the passanger side of the motor. Just make sure you dont pinch the coil pack when jacking up. take it slow and dont force anything.
